Historical Context
Waste Management Inc. has a long history of providing waste management services, dating back to 1968. Over the years, the company has expanded its operations through strategic acquisitions and investments in new technologies. In the 1990s, Waste Management Inc. began to focus on recycling and waste reduction, recognizing the growing importance of environmental sustainability.

Peer Comparison
The following table provides a comparison of key financial metrics for Waste Management Inc. and its peers:
| Company | Revenue (2025) | Net Income (2025) | EBITDA Margin (2025) | Price-to-Earnings Ratio (2026)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Waste Management Inc. | $17.3B | $1.4B | 23.1% | 25.1 |
| Republic Services Inc. | $11.3B | $943M | 20.5% | 22.5 |
| Waste Connections Inc. | $6.2B | $541M | 21.1% | 24.3 |
As shown in the table, Waste Management Inc. has a strong financial profile, with high revenue and net income growth. The company’s EBITDA margin is also among the highest in the industry, reflecting its operational efficiency.
